ILA most commonly refers to Integrated Logistics Analysis. This is a broad term covering tools and methodologies for optimizing supply chain management, transportation, and related logistical activities. It's used to improve efficiency, reduce costs, and enhance overall performance within the logistics domain. Another less common usage is Instruction Level Abstraction, relating to reverse engineering of software. Without more context, it's hard to know the intended use of the acronym.
